Fête des Lumières 2013 (Lyon – France)
The Fête des Lumières (in English : Festival of Lights) was first held in Lyon in 1852 to coincide with the inauguration of the statue of the Virgin Mary which was erected at the top of the Fourvière hill. The people of Lyon would spontaneously light up the city’s facades by placing little candles on their window ledges. During four evenings around December 8th, the city is taken over by videographers, computer graphic artists and lighting designers who transform it into an open air theatre quite unlike any other in the world.
